We led a mixed-methods study examining how Ontario’s creative industries are adopting generative AI for business operations and administration. Through a sector-wide survey, industry focus group, and literature review, the research identified current use cases, barriers, policy and training gaps, and opportunities to support responsible AI adoption across the sector.
Welland Public Library adopted its new Strategic Plan, What’s Possible at the Library (2026–2030). The plan establishes a clear roadmap to help the Library respond to a growing and evolving community through three strategic priorities focused on inspiring curiosity and learning, enhancing experience and engagement, and investing in people and places.
Located along the Oxford County Cheese Trail, the Ingersoll Cheese & Agricultural Museum is an important cultural landmark and community gathering place. We worked with the Town of Ingersoll to develop a 10-year enhancement plan that will help shape the Museum’s future.
